When you use Elastic's #Logstash http output plugin, you can send logs to a HTTP endpoint (e.g. to a HTTP API), sometimes also named #logsink. πͺ΅ β¬οΈ
The plugin's format setting allows a couple of options. But what is the actual difference between the default "json" value and "json_batch"? π€
Here's an actual example to see the differences in a practical way.
